From Emmanuel Uzor, Awka

Anambra State Governor Prof Chukwuma Soludo has assented to the 2024 Appropriation bill.

Governor Soludo while signing the budget into law thanked all stakeholders who have been involved in the entire process, pointing out that Anambra State House of Assembly worked very hard to see that the Law meets the needs and aspirations of Ndi Anambra.

The governor revealed that with the budget in hand, the real transformation of the state using the five pillars of his administration will now begin.

He noted that infrastructure and human capital are among the front burners of the budget plan.

By signing the bill into law, the state government is now empowered to the implement its provisions in the allowed fiscal year.

Daily Sun reported that Governor Soludo had presented the 2024 budget estimate of N410, 132, 225, 272 to Anambra state House of Assembly.

The budget, which is 57.8% higher than that of the 2023 budget, is focused on infrastructure development, education, and healthcare.

Governor Soludo also signed into Law the bill that repealed the Anambra State Publishing and Newspaper Printing Corporation.
